In Episode 3 of Desert Diaries: A Lenten Journey with Bishop Kulick, we enter a desert many people know well: fear.
When life slows down, anxiety, insecurity, comparison, and the pressure to be “enough” can grow louder. Bishop Larry J. Kulick reflects on how fear works — how it narrows our vision, distorts our identity, and creates “mirages” that feel real but aren’t rooted in truth.
